January 12, 2026, marks 17 years and 9 days since Bitcoin's inception. The current price remains steady at $91,333.34, having completed 9.13% of the journey to the million-dollar mark—progress may be slow, but every step is accumulating.
Market sentiment is facing a test. The Fear and Greed Index has fallen to 26, indicating extreme fear. Such extreme emotions often breed opportunities—when the market is pessimistic, it often signals a bottom. Long-term holders should remain patient at this time; short-term volatility cannot obscure Bitcoin's long-term value proposition as a digital asset.
Looking at the span of its existence, Bitcoin has proven its resilience. Every market panic is laying the groundwork for the next wave of growth.
